Decorative Round Wide Borders from Just Rite and paired it with a sentiment from Birthday Centers. I embossed the border in clear embossing powder and then cut it out with 2 circle nestabilities. The
twill ribbon is puckered and taped to the card with sticky strip - to pucker the twill, pull on one of the threads that run along the length of the ribbon and you'll see it start to gather. You can tie the ends when you get the right length, or simple cut the ends after adhering it to your card. So easy!
